Can I have hummus on paleo?

Is hummus paleo? When it is made with chickpeas, no, hummus is not Paleo. Chickpeas are a legume and legumes are not Paleo. However, if you make hummus without chickpeas, and make it out of something else, like cauliflower, then, you can enjoy it!

Is almond milk OK on Paleo diet?

Almonds are considered compliant with the diet, for example, but is almond milk Paleo? Typically, almond milk does not meet Paleo guidelines because it often contains added sugar and stabilizers and emulsifiers like locust bean gum, sunflower lecithin and gellan gum.

Can you eat potato on Paleo?

Unprocessed potatoes are paleo

Generally, unprocessed potatoes of all types can be part of a paleo diet. Similarly to grains, which are off-limits on paleo, potatoes are starchy and rich in carbohydrates. However, potatoes are actually a type of starchy vegetable that grows underground, known as a tuber ( 2 , 3 ).

Is yogurt allowed on Paleo diet?

A strict paleo diet does not allow dairy products because hunter-gatherers did not milk cows. This includes milk, butter, yogurt, sour cream, and cheese.

Why paleo diet is unhealthy?

In terms of overall health, the paleo diet is high in saturated fats due to the increased intake of protein from animal food sources. Over time, people following the diet could see increases in cholesterol, particularly the less healthy cholesterol. This could increase the risk of heart disease.

Can you have popcorn on paleo?

Popcorn is technically not considered paleo since it's a whole grain. However, most paleo experts agree that it's not a horrible snack to have in moderation, especially when it's prepared fresh and cooked in a healthy fat like coconut oil.

Can I eat rice on paleo?

Grains are generally prohibited on the paleo diet

Grains are one of the major food groups prohibited on the paleo diet. These include wheat, corn, bread, pasta, cereal, oats, rye, barley, and rice.

Can you have peanut butter on paleo?

Peanuts are technically legumes, which are not paleo compliant, and that means peanut butter is off limits for paleo eaters. All other nuts and seeds are fair game, so if nuts and seeds are the only ingredients, snack away!
